The Agency will satisfy the Federal reporting requirements for the project(s), such as the monthly <br />employment report, for both the Contractor and Subcontractor. The Agency will provide the required <br />information on form(s) provided by the Department in the timeframe indicated in the instructions. The Agency <br />will ensure that the reporting requirements are included in all ARRA contracts and subcontracts. <br /> <br />The Agency will withhold the Contractor's progress payments, project acceptance, and final payment for failure <br />to comply with the requirements of the 2009 ARRA. <br /> <br />Authority of the U.S. Comptroller General <br /> <br />Section 902 of the 2009 ARRA provides the U.S. Comptroller General and his representatives the authority: <br /> <br />1. To examine any records of the Contractor or any of its Subcontractors, or any State or Local Agency <br />administering such contract, that directly pertain to, and involve transactions relating to, the contract or <br />subcontract; and <br /> <br />2. To interview any officer or employee of the Contractor or any of its Subcontractors, or of any State or Local <br />Agency administering the contract, regarding such transactions. <br /> <br />Accordingly, the U.S. Comptroller General and his representatives shall have the authority and rights as <br />provided under Section 902 of the 2009 ARRA with respect to this contract, which is funded with funds made <br />available under the 2009 ARRA. Section 902 further states that nothing in this Section shall be interpreted to <br />limit or restrict, in any way, any existing authority of the U.S. Comptroller General. <br /> <br />Authority of the U.S. Inspector General <br /> <br />Section 1515(a) of the 2009 ARRA provides authority for any representatives of the Inspector General to <br />examine any records or interview any employee or officers working on this contract. The Contractor is advised <br />that representatives of the U.S. Inspector General have the authority to examine any record and interview any <br />employee or officer of the Contractor, its Subcontractors or other firms working on this contract. Section <br />1515(b) further provides that nothing in this Section shall be interpreted to limit or restrict, in any way, any <br />existing authority of the Inspector Geheral. . <br />'j . <br /> <br />'.:~.'" <br />
